136 votes

Comment puis-je remplacer les styles en ligne par des CSS externes ?

J'ai un balisage qui utilise des styles en ligne, mais je n'ai pas accès à la modification de ce balisage. Comment puis-je remplacer les styles en ligne dans un document en utilisant uniquement les CSS ? Je ne veux pas utiliser jQuery ou JavaScript.

HTML :

<div style="font-size: 18px; color: red;">
    Hello World, How Can I Change The Color To Blue?
</div>

CSS :

div {
   color: blue; 
   /* This Isn't Working */
}

0voto

!important après votre déclaration CSS.

div {
   color: blue !important; 

   /* This Is Now Working */
}

-1voto

Syed Akhter Points 19
div {
 color : blue !important;
}

<div style="color : red">
  hello
</div>

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X